Born again adults are those who believe they will experience an afterlife in the presence of God only because they have confessed their sins against Him and accepted Jesus Christ as the redeemer who saves them from eternal punishment.

According to George Barna’s extensive research, talks about 30% of the U.S. population are “born again” Christians.

And, 30% represents a significant drop from nearly half of the adult population meeting the same criteria just two decades ago.

Here are the findings on those who fit the born-again criteria. You’ll find much of this troubling:

  • Three out of every four born again adults (76%) believe that the Bible is the inerrant Word of God. They should all believe it is.
  • Seven out of ten (70%) contend that the Bible is totally accurate in all of the life principles it teaches.
  • (46%) read the Bible at least once a week – a terrible percentage.
  • (77%) believe that all people are basically good. This, of course is a non-Biblical belief.
  • (67%) argue that having faith is more important than which faith you embrace. Again, a non-Biblical belief.
  • 90% have a biblically solid concept of the nature of God
  • 80% agree that God is actively involved in peoples’ lives today
  • 30% believe the Holy Spirit is not a living being but is simply a symbol of God’s presence or purity
  • 50% believe the false idea that because Jesus Christ was human, He sinned
  • 60% believe that a good person or someone who does enough good deeds can earn their way into Heaven
  • 54% have conservative views about the ideal size, reach, and power of government
  • 34% say they prefer socialism to capitalism

In the recent presidential election, 84% of SAGE Cons (Spiritually Active, Governance Engaged Conservatives) were registered Republicans and 93% of all SAGE Cons voted for Donald Trump. In contrast, just 44% of born again adults are registered Republicans. In the November election, 60% of the nation’s born again Christians sided with Donald Trump.
